Revista Brasileira de Ciências Ambientais: News https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B <div style="display: grid; grid-template-columns: 1fr 1fr; gap: 24px; align-items: start;"> <div style="padding-top: 0;"> <p style="font-size: 16px; line-height: 1.6;">The Brazilian Journal of Environmental Sciences (RBCIAMB) publishes high-quality, peer-reviewed original research addressing complex socio-environmental challenges through interdisciplinary approaches. The journal prioritizes studies that integrate scientific, technological, and management dimensions of the interactions between society and nature, as well as their implications for sustainable development. RBCIAMB is an open-access journal with no article processing charges (APC) and is committed to disseminating scientific knowledge in support of sustainable development.</p> <p style="margin-top: 18px; The project strengthens indigenous peoples and traditional communities in the Amazon and Cerrado biomes to produce, manage and govern sociobiodiversity data, fostering symmetrical dialogue between scientific and traditional knowledge systems. The fellow will coordinate intercultural research, systematize knowledge and contribute to science, technology and innovation policies for biodiversity conservation. Fellowship R$ 4,000/month · 15h/week · Deadline: June 12, 2026. As inscrições devem ser feitas até a próxima sexta-feira (05/06). O projeto é conduzido no Instituto de Estudos Avançados da Universidade de São Paulo (IEA-USP). Os candidatos devem ter doutorado obtido há, no máximo, sete anos em ecologia, ciências ambientais ou áreas afins. É necessária experiência sólida com programação em linguagem R ou Python, uso de grandes bancos de dados, modelagem ecológica de nicho e análise espacial. Além disso, os candidatos devem ter experiência comprovada em colaboração com grupos transdisciplinares, especialmente em processos de coprodução de conhecimento voltados ao desenvolvimento ou aprimoramento de políticas públicas com tomadores de decisão. É desejável experiência de campo com pelo menos um dos grupos taxonômicos a serem modelados. Mais informações sobre as vagas e as inscrições em: <a href="https://www.fapesp.br/oportunidades/9435/">www.fapesp.br/oportunidades/9435/</a>. As oportunidades de pós-doutorado estão abertas a brasileiros e estrangeiros. Os selecionados receberão bolsa no valor de R$ 12.570,00 mensais e Reserva Técnica equivalente a 10% do valor anual da bolsa para atender a despesas imprevistas e diretamente relacionadas à atividade de pesquisa. Caso o bolsista de PD resida em domicílio fora da cidade na qual se localiza a instituição-sede da pesquisa e precise se mudar, poderá ter direito a um auxílio-instalação. The document provides practical guidance for institutions to apply the Framework in a responsible and reproducible manner, with a focus on Web of Science Research Intelligence — Clarivate's new analytical platform.</p> <p class="font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al leading-[1.7]">The guide combines categorization driven by the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), diverse data sources, and clear recommendations for interpretation, enabling institutions and researchers to demonstrate the real-world impact of their research beyond traditional citation-based metrics.</p> <p class="font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al leading-[1.7]">Among the Framework's core principles are: the use of indicators as signals, not as proof; the distinction between potential and observed impact; and the responsible aggregation of data into Societal Impact Profiles. The approach is particularly aligned with RBCIAMB's mission regarding indicators related to sustainable development.</p> <p class="font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al leading-[1.7]"><strong><a class="underline underline underline-offset-2 decoration-1 decoration-current/40 hover:decoration-current focus:decoration-current" href="https://clarivate.com/academia-government/wp-content/uploads/sites/3/dlm_uploads/2026/04/Clarivate-Societal-IMpact-Framework-a-guide-to-responsible-research-impact-measurement.pdf">Download the guide (PDF)</a></strong></p> </div> </div> </div> </div> </div> </div> </div> </div> https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B/announcement/view/17 Tue, 02 Jun 2026 13:21:12 -0300 RBCIAMB Co-founder Arlindo Philippi Jr. awarded the Anísio Teixeira Higher Education Award https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B/announcement/view/16 <div style="max-width: 980px; margin: 0 auto; font-family: 'Helvetica Neue', Arial, sans-serif; color: #2b2b2b; line-height: 1.8;"><!-- IMAGE --> <div style="text-align: center; margin-bottom: 12px;"><img src="https://www.rbciamb.com.br/public/site/images/vfernandes/prof-arlindo-6983-web-jpg-78f652ab1effa4d5110be878f8f524d9.jpg" alt="" width="345" height="500" /></div> <!-- CAPTION --> <p style="font-size: 13px; color: #666; text-align: center; margin-top: 0; margin-bottom: 36px;">Professor Arlindo Philippi Jr., RBCIAMB co-founder, Emeritus Editor and Editorial Board member. He also served in important environmental institutions and public agencies, including CETESB and Ibama.</p> <p>His academic production, institutional leadership, and interdisciplinary work have significantly contributed to the consolidation of Environmental Sciences as a scientific field in Brazil, contributing to the education of generations of researchers and strengthening graduate programs and public policies across the country.</p> <p>At <strong>RBCIAMB</strong>, Professor Arlindo Philippi Jr. played a fundamental role since the journal’s foundation, directly contributing to its consolidation as one of Brazil’s leading scientific journals in the environmental field. His contribution continues through his participation on the journal’s Editorial Board, supporting the scientific quality, relevance, and credibility of the publication.</p> <p><strong>RBCIAMB</strong> congratulates Professor Arlindo Philippi Jr. on this important recognition, which honors his remarkable academic and institutional trajectory and represents a source of pride for the entire Environmental Sciences community.</p> </div> https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B/announcement/view/16 Sat, 16 May 2026 11:03:26 -0300 RBCIAMB Associate Editor Receives "The Earth's Future Award" https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B/announcement/view/12 <p>Professor Helen Treichel of the Federal University of the Southern Frontier (UFFS) will be awarded the <a href="https://fapergs.rs.gov.br/jornal-do-comercio-e-fapergs-reconhecem-pesquisadores-com-o-premio-o-futuro-da-terra?fbclid=IwY2xjawMZVThleHRuA2FlbQIxMABicmlkETE0Y3ZWbGZuY3RIMXVqT240AR5fLFB6XXNGvEIrVrFVTjFD-LSaJwajmim3OrHRDdg5ojg-XbkM1wZJ6YnpXg_aem_C7T16BhqBoTwBo3p-twtLA"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Earth's Future Award</a> in the Environmental Preservation category. It is a fitting tribute to their critical role for development.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">But today, the tribute is not just for their outstanding scientific achievements and contributions for the development of Brazil, but also is a tribute to the importance of diversity, inclusion, and a functioning body politic.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">In the current context, the Brazilian scientific community, beyond its typical activities, continues its fight against misinformation, resource cuts, and the social devaluation of science. Therefore, many scientists have gone public, through social networks, producing content to inform and educate society.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">In Environmental Sciences, this is no different. In addition to producing knowledge about the various aspects of sustainable development, there is a constant effort to enrich public discourse about the importance of the environment, the consequences of negative impacts, and about the continuous need to seek a balance among the various activities of society in the broadest sense, especially as it concerns the maintenance of the ecosystems upon which society depends.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">Therefore, this year's tribute is not just to the scientist who lives in each and every one of us and the science developed by our community, but also for those who fight for diversity, citizenship, inclusion, and democratization of knowledge through their expertise and activities.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">Congratulations to each and every one who contributes to making RBCIAMB a reputable scientific journal in the Environmental Sciences.</p> <p style="font-weight: 400;">Prof. Valdir Fernandes</p> https://www.rbciamb.com.br/Publicacoes_RBCIAMB/announcement/view/7 Fri, 08 Jul 2022 14:58:19 -0300
